Slant Theatre Project and Kelli Giddish in association with Wheelhouse Theater are proud to present the World Premiere of Lawrence Dial's IN THE ROOM, directed by Adam Knight (Naperville) at the Alchemical Theatre (104 West 14th Street between 6th and 7th Avenue) tonight, October 20, through November 13.

In the Rise and Fall of a Teenage Cyberqueen, a new play by Lindsay Joy Murphy, everyone in a small town is searching for something online. Love. Sex. Popularity. What they don't realize is the internet is a masquerade. Video cams play tricks with your eyes. Online chat rooms strip away anonymity. Self-deception is disguised as the truth. Inevitably, cyberspace exacts a price when people are no longer able to hide.

ELR Productions, LLC will present the Off-Broadway premiere of THE AUSTERITY OF HOPE, a new drama by Dan Fingerman about gay relationships set to the backdrop of the 2008 Obama campaign, with previews beginning Friday, October 19th on the mainstage at the Abingdon Theatre Arts Complex, 312 West 36th street. The official opening will be on Sunday, October 21, 2012. Dan Dinero Directs.
